Web1. On the Model Tree, click Show> Layer Tree. Any existing layers are listed. 2. Define the layer to place the drawing items on: To create a new layer, click Layer> New Layer. The Layer Propertiesdialog box opens. To place the items on an existing layer, right-click the layer and click Layer Properties. The Layer Propertiesdialog box opens. 3. WebYou can make the view layer permanently dependent on the drawing layer by clicking Layer above the Layer Tree, and clicking Copy Status From > Drawing. Alternatively, select a layer on the Layer Tree, right-click, and click Copy Status From > Drawing. However, once you do this you cannot reset the status of the view layer. Was this helpful?
